#bd7f0e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bd7f0e is composed of 74.1% red, 49.8%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 32.8% magenta, 92.6% yellow and 25.9% black. It has a hue angle of 38.7 degrees, a saturation of 86.2% and a lightness of 39.8%. #bd7f0e color hex could be obtained by blending #fffe1c with #7b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#bd7f0e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bd7f0e has RGB values of R:189, G:127,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.93, K:0.26. Its decimal value is 12418830.
